Meta Platforms, Inc. stock rose about 0.5% in premarket trading Tuesday, as risk appetite strengthened with big tech leading gains. Nasdaq futures rose 0.49%, and S&P 500 futures rose 0.20%.

Meta Prepares to Launch Hatch AI Agent Platform

Meta is working to turn its massive AI investments into new consumer revenue streams. According to The Information, the company plans to launch an internally developed AI agent platform called Hatch in the coming weeks.

Meta is considering a tiered subscription model for Hatch. Its highest-priced plan could cost $199.99 per month and offer higher usage limits, the report said.

The platform will give users access to AI agents that can interact with websites and services, complete tasks, and use specialized tools through a customizable dashboard.

WhatsApp May Expand Agent Coverage

Meta is also preparing an AI agent platform for WhatsApp. The service will allow users to connect and interact with other agents via the messaging app. A limited rollout could begin as early as this week.

These projects advance CEO Mark Zuckerberg's push to build AI-driven businesses beyond Meta's core advertising operations.

Watermelon Adds to Meta's AI Roadmap

The company also plans to release a new AI model codenamed Watermelon in October, aiming to accelerate its agentic AI work and compete with OpenAI and Anthropic.

Meta plans to monetize AI through higher engagement, improved recommendations, assistants, messaging, and devices, rather than relying solely on model sales. Its open-weight strategy can lower AI costs while strengthening products that already reach billions of users.
